AP Police Recruitment 2025: The Andhra Pradesh State Level Police Recruitment Board (AP SLPRB) is expected to release the notification for the next cycle of police recruitment, potentially covering the 2026-27 session. This recruitment drive is anticipated to be a major opportunity for job seekers, following a recent directive from the High Court to the state government to take a decision on filling a total of 11,639 vacancies within the police department within six weeks (as of November 2025). The official notification is expected to be published soon on the SLPRB official website.

Vacancy Details

The Andhra Pradesh government has confirmed approval for 11,639 vacancies to be filled under the Special Police Force, distributed across Sub Inspector (SI) and Constable posts. Final, post-wise distribution will be confirmed upon the release of the detailed notification.

Eligibility Criteria

Educational Qualification

Post NameEducational Qualification
Sub Inspector (SI)Must hold a Graduation Degree or equivalent in any discipline from a recognized university.
Police ConstableMust have passed 10+2 (Intermediate) from a recognized board/institution.

Age Limit (as per existing norms, subject to 2026 notification)

The age limits are typically calculated as on a specific cut-off date mentioned in the notification.

CategoryConstable Age LimitSub Inspector (SI) Age Limit
General/UR18 – 27 Years (expected with relaxation)21 – 30 Years (expected with relaxation)
SC/ST18 – 32 Years (up to 5 years relaxation)21 – 35 Years (up to 5 years relaxation)

Selection Process

The selection process is multi-stage and candidates must qualify at each stage to move forward.

  1. Preliminary Written Examination: An initial objective-type screening test.

  2. Physical Measurement Test (PMT): Assessment of mandatory height and chest measurements.

  3. Physical Efficiency Test (PET): Performance-based tests including running and long jump.

  4. Final Written Examination: The main examination, which determines the final merit ranking.

  5. Document Verification: Verification of all original certificates and documents.

  6. Final Merit List: Prepared based on marks obtained in the Final Written Examination.

Physical Standards (Expected)

CriteriaSI (Male)SI (Female)Constable (Male)Constable (Female)
HeightNot less than 167.6 cmNot less than 152.5 cmNot less than 162 cmNot less than 150 cm
Chest (Male only)Not less than 86.3 cm (with 5 cm expansion)Not ApplicableNot less than 80 cm (with 3 cm expansion)Not Applicable
WeightNot ApplicableNot less than 40 kgsAbove 65 kg (expected)Above 50 kg (expected)

Expected Salary Structure

The expected pay scale for the posts is determined by the Andhra Pradesh government pay rules.

PostPay ScaleExpected Monthly Salary (Approx.)
Sub Inspector (SI)₹44,570 to ₹1,27,480₹49,000 to ₹60,000
Police Constable₹25,220 to ₹80,910₹30,000 to ₹40,000
